## Break-Glass Access: FormulaCell Sandbox

User-supplied formulas in Tallygrove run inside the FormulaCell sandbox with no filesystem or network reach. Reviewers should reject any change that widens the interpreter's allowlist. If the sandbox supervisor wedges and blocks all evaluation, break-glass entry to the supervisor console is permitted. Unlock it with the recovery passphrase shown immediately below.

unlock words, kawig-bawef: belax-sorir-druax-ulaiel-wenael-belael

Test note — monthly partitioning on the Bramblewick orders table.

We're splitting `orders` by month starting with the oldest data; check that queries spanning a month boundary still return complete results, and that the partition-drop job skips the current month. Watch insert latency during the cutover, too. To run the verification queries against the staging warehouse, authenticate with the bearer token below.

login token, bagug-kafop: eyJhbGciOiJIUzI1NiIsInR5cCI6IkpXVCJ9.eyJzdWIiOiIcMLov2In0.Z5RLDIfp

Subject: Inkwell markdown pipeline 5.1 deployed

On-call: the Inkwell rendering pipeline is now on 5.1 in production. Changes: sanitizer runs before the table parser, footnote rendering is cached per document, and the fallback plain-text path no longer strips headings. If render latency alarms fire, roll back via the standard script — it handles cache invalidation. Known issue: nested blockquotes over six levels render flat. The deployment trace token follows.

build token for hawep-kageg: htk14_558814e2114cc7